We already have one humidity sensor in our offer – Honywell HCH-1000-002, however it’s use it is not so simple. First You need to build and calibrate RC circuit, before You can read useful readings. Thus we have added Grove Humidity and Temperature Sensor from SeeedStudio to our offer – use is much more easier, and more important – sensors are already calibrated.
